Evaluating IPTV Streaming Quality: HD, fourK, and Beyond
The evolution of television has been marked by significant advancements in technology, with IPTV (Internet Protocol Television) rising as a popular technique for delivering television content over the internet. Because the demand for higher-quality video content grows, IPTV providers have expanded their offerings to incorporate numerous resolutions reminiscent of HD, fourK, and even higher. This article delves into the variations between HD, fourK, and past in IPTV streaming quality, exploring the benefits and challenges associated with each.
HD (High Definition) Streaming
HD, or High Definition, was the first main leap in television resolution, offering a significant improvement over customary definition (SD). HD typically refers to resolutions of 720p (1280x720 pixels) or 1080p (1920x1080 pixels). The transition to HD introduced sharper images, better color accuracy, and more detail, enhancing the general viewing experience.
Within the context of IPTV, HD streaming remains a popular selection due to its balance between quality and bandwidth requirements. Most internet connections can comfortably support HD streaming, which generally requires a minimal bandwidth of 5-eight Mbps. This makes HD a practical option for a wide audience, including those with average internet speeds.
The benefits of HD embody a transparent and crisp image, which is suitable for a wide range of content types, from sports to movies. However, as screen sizes improve and consumer expectations rise, the limitations of HD become more apparent, leading to the demand for higher resolutions like fourK.
4K (Ultra High Definition) Streaming
4K, additionally known as Ultra High Definition (UHD), presents a decision of 3840x2160 pixels, which is 4 instances the number of pixels found in 1080p HD. The jump from HD to 4K is noticeable, with vastly improved clarity, finer details, and more vibrant colors. This resolution is particularly beneficial for big screens, where the elevated pixel density could be fully appreciated.
Streaming fourK content material via IPTV requires more robust internet infrastructure, as it typically demands a minimal bandwidth of 25 Mbps. This can be a limitation for customers with slower internet connections or data caps. Additionally, not all content material is available in fourK, and never all gadgets assist 4K streaming, requiring viewers to ensure their equipment is compatible.
Despite these challenges, 4K streaming presents a significant upgrade for these seeking a more immersive viewing experience. The detailed images and superior colour depth make it excellent for nature documentaries, blockbuster motion pictures, and high-end gaming.
Beyond fourK: eightK and Future Resolutions
The push for ever-higher resolutions continues with the advent of eightK, which boasts a resolution of 7680x4320 pixels. This leap presents sixteen times the decision of 1080p HD and 4 instances that of 4K. The element and realism provided by eightK are astounding, creating an almost lifelike viewing experience. However, the practical implementation of eightK IPTV streaming faces significant hurdles.
Streaming eightK content material requires huge bandwidth, with estimates suggesting a necessity for at the very least 50-one hundred Mbps. Additionally, the availability of 8K content material is currently limited, and very few consumers own eightK-compatible devices. The price of 8K televisions and the mandatory internet infrastructure also pose significant boundaries to widespread adoption.
Looking additional into the future, we will count on continued advancements in resolution and streaming quality. Technologies corresponding to Virtual Reality (VR) and Augmented Reality (AR) will likely drive demand for higher resolutions and more sophisticated streaming capabilities. The development of more efficient video compression algorithms and advancements in internet infrastructure will play crucial roles in making these high-decision streams accessible to a broader audience.
